Expert AI · Mechanic's Insight
This Lexus CT maintains an exceptionally stable roadworthiness profile. The most recent MOT on 15 December 2025 at 56,659 miles resulted in a pass with no defects recorded. This clean bill of health follows a consistent trend of five consecutive passes without a single advisory or failure, indicating a vehicle that has been kept in peak mechanical condition. The mileage is remarkably low for a 2013 model, averaging roughly 4,358 miles per year. The data shows a steady increase in usage over the last few years, moving from 40,510 miles in September 2022 to 56,659 miles by December 2025. This gradual accumulation suggests the car has avoided long periods of stagnation, which often cause seals to perish or batteries to fail. While the MOT record is flawless, the low mileage and lack of reported wear on consumables are atypical for a thirteen year old vehicle. A buyer should verify the condition of the brake discs and calipers during a physical inspection to ensure they have not suffered from surface corrosion or seizing due to light use. Check the tyre date codes to confirm they have been replaced based on age rather than tread wear. Given the absence of any flagged suspension bushes or coil spring fatigue in the history, the chassis likely remains in excellent condition, but a visual check for underbody corrosion is always prudent for a car of this vintage.
